If one approaches K-Electric to have an anomaly corrected in a bill, officials dealing with customer complaints suggest that one should make the payment first. Then they demand an application to be addressed to the management for correcting the mistake and from then a long process starts. Every month you have to visit the utility office and the case remains pending for months. This is especially true for the old town zone. The interesting part is that the power utility also claims reconnection charges of Rs 2,000. Now one may ask, what was our fault in the whole episode? The authorities concerned are requested to take action against this injustice.
